Default Diffs in the newer trucks between.....

A REgular 4x4 and a z71?

From what ive seen with the 4x4 and the Z-71 package is the Z-71 comes with an off-road suspension and skidplates.

The Z71 has different shocks, slightly larger tires- 265 vs 245 and one more skid plate than the regular 4x4s (at least mine) Mine has a plate up front and one for the transfer case, the Z71 has one for the fuel tank
